Plot – The Main Story 

This film explores the dark side of capitalism and greed in a way that feels more gripping than most recent films about business.

There will be blood is a drama film directed by Paul Thomas Anderson. The film was released in 2007 and stars Daniel Day-Lewis as Daniel Plainview, an oilman on a ruthless quest for wealth.

Daniel Plainview (Day-Lewis) was a prospector in the early 20th century, just as the oil industry is being born. He starts off as a worker for a small-time prospector and discovers oil near Santa Fe.

He uses his newfound wealth to build a large oil empire in the early 20th century but starts to lose his grip on reality as he ages.

There Will Be Blood-Cast And Characters

  • Daniel Day-Lewis as Daniel Plainview
  • Paul Dano as Paul & Eli Sunday
  • Kevin J. O’Connor as Henry
  • Ciarán Hinds as Fletcher Hamilton
  • Russell Harvard as H.W. Plainview
    • Dillon Freasier as young H.W. Plainview
  • Colleen Foy as Mary Sunday
    • Sydney McCallister as young Mary Sunday
  • David Willis as Abel Sunday
  • Hans Howes as Bandy
  • Paul F. Tompkins as Prescott
  • Jim Downey as Al Rose
  • David Warshofsky as H.M. Tilford
  • Barry Del Sherman as H.B. Ailman
